Journal Communications Inc. today announced that its board has named Andre Fernandez president in addition to his role as chief financial officer. Steven Smith, who was president, will remain chairman and chief executive officer of the parent company of the Milwaukee Journal Sentinel.
"This additional title recognizes the significant role Andre plays on our leadership team," Smith said. "He has been instrumental in the continuing evolution of our business, the steady focus on building our local media brands and the sustained investment in our digital business. Andre has also helped us maintain our strong financial disciplines which have led to Journal's consistently improving balance sheet. We look forward to Andre's increased operational responsibilities across the company."
Fernandez joined Journal Communications in October 2008 from NBC Universal, where he was senior vice president, chief financial officer and treasurer for Telemundo Communications Group Inc. Prior to Telemundo, he served in a number of financial leadership roles for General Electric Corp.
